如何在googlecolab上安装mayavi?

2024-04-25 04:21:13 发布

您现在位置:Python中文网/ 问答频道 /正文

我尝试使用pip在Colab上安装mayavi

!pip install mayavi

这引发了以下错误:

Running setup.py bdist_wheel for mayavi ... error

其余的错误输出可在Colab document处获得。在


解决方案:正在工作

根据@Bob-Smith的响应,我发现他的解决方案在安装依赖项时需要稍作修改:

!apt-get install vtk6
!apt-get install libvtk6-dev python-vtk6


遇到的问题和解决方法(PFWF)

PFWF-001!apt-get install python-vtk引发以下错误:

Package 'python-vtk' has no installation candidate

我找到了一个command-reference

!apt-get install libvtk5-dev python-vtk

然而,这个命令也不起作用。包名称已从libvtk5-dev更改为libvtk6-devpython binding for VTK已从python-vtk更改为python-vtk6。显然,这种更改在将来还会继续发生,您可能需要在运行以下语句之前检查包名和VTK的python绑定:

!apt-get install libvtk6-dev python-vtk6

注意:如果您在这里寻找解决python的VTK安装问题,但这并不能解决您可能希望在这里查看的问题:installing-vtk-for-python


安装mayavi仍会引发错误:
尽管上面的两个步骤安装了依赖项,但最后一行:!pip install mayavi会出现以下错误

Could not connect to any X display.

关于Mayavi安装的最新进展可以在这里找到

https://colab.research.google.com/drive/1K_VIP9izNLKalD_IgBSiTowyNkU7aWcW


Tags: installpipdevforget错误apt解决方案